Transaction 3262b2b9a169637d54314bbff4e0975a1fd31f2588e25a5c1622f558af4c439b

13 Input
2 Outputs
  • 3262b2b9a169637d54314bbff4e0975a1fd31f2588e25a5c1622f558af4c439b:0
  • value  988023
    address  3HdMWSshSq74enCx23hwemEXUjQeLcC7qX
  • 3262b2b9a169637d54314bbff4e0975a1fd31f2588e25a5c1622f558af4c439b:1
  • value  452017583
    address  3BrfBmEqWNcPtmWamXuGnjfo8LX54ieGvz